Prediction Philippines vs Myanmar 2026 – Betting Tips for the Friendly International on 09/06/2026

Preview: Rizal Memorial set for attacking fireworks

The friendly at Rizal Memorial Stadium on June 9 promises to be an engaging contest between two Asian sides arriving in strong attacking rhythm. Philippines come off a comfortable 5-1 victory over Guam on June 3, a performance that underlined their recent unbeaten run and confidence under the bright Manila sun. Jarvey Gayoso was the standout in that encounter, earning the best player nod as the hosts displayed a ruthless touch in front of goal. Myanmar, arriving a few days later after a 6-1 demolition of Guam themselves, will not be intimidated. Their own run of results shows a team capable of putting the ball in the net in bunches, even if they have suffered heavy defeats in the past against stronger opposition.

Form and momentum — why this should be an open match

Looking strictly at form and the most recent meetings, both sides have enviable scoring figures. The Philippines’ recent sequence reads like the sort of momentum any coach would envy: a run devoid of defeats and peppered with wins and draws that suggest solidity and invention going forward. Myanmar’s form is slightly more volatile but equally potent in attack — multiple recent wins with high goal returns mixed with a couple of heavier reversals. Their head-to-head history isn’t one-sided; their last meeting ended 1-1, but that result came in a competitive ASEAN Championship setting, not the free-flowing environment of friendlies where coaches often tinker and forwards are encouraged to express themselves.

Tactical indicators from the recent scorelines point toward open spaces and heavy shot volumes. Both teams produced double-digit total shots and multiple on-target efforts in their latest fixtures, which bodes well for goal-rich entertainment. Corners, dangerous attacks, and a willingness to press high make Rizal Memorial’s 12,000-capacity turf an ideal stage for end-to-end action.

Context and what to watch

Friendlies often provide fewer defensive constraints and more experimental selections; that should further increase chances for scoring. The hosts will be buoyed by home support and recent cohesion, while Myanmar’s confidence from scoring freely will keep them dangerous on transitions. Expect both teams to prioritize momentum and attacking patterns over cautious, low-risk setups.
